    Raya, I have 4 Mossies, 2 are much smaller in size and one does all the calling. When I bought them I requested at least 1 females, but I think that I have 2 of each. I have been taking some of the water out every day to make them think it is a dry spell, I can't take out all the water because of the fish. Well, actually, I guess I can take the fish out if I have to. I have guppies in there that I think they are eating, to many to count. I have them in a large vivarium and when I feed them crickets or the Dubia roaches I wait till dark and put a whole bunch in, like 3 doz or so. Some get eaten, some drown and some hide...only to be eaten at a later date. They all look ok, I don't think there is such a thing as a fat Mossie...they all look thin to me, but that is part of who they are. Congratulations on your new frogs!
